Commit Graph

30 Commits

Author SHA1 Message Date
Alexey Sokolov
d13742b132 Add test for znc-buildmod 2016-01-09 22:01:33 +00:00
Alexey Sokolov
c1595d0c19 Int test: run executable from installation dir instead of source 2016-01-09 20:47:00 +00:00
Alexey Sokolov
ad0c332454 Add test for encoding change 2016-01-09 20:26:22 +00:00
Alexey Sokolov
1f226d2ade Add test for #1229 and actually fix it. 2016-01-09 18:00:47 +00:00
Alexey Sokolov
6a87ba3d4f Disable perl and python tests in coverage. 2016-01-09 15:15:43 +00:00
Alexey Sokolov
780659b139 Add basic tests for modperl and modpython 2016-01-07 00:52:52 +00:00
Falk Seidel
8f73840e74 Welcome to 2016
🎆  Happy 2016 🎆
2016-01-01 20:11:21 +01:00
Alexey Sokolov
16a8c77737 Replace virtual with override where possible.
Using clang-tidy
2015-12-08 20:51:50 +00:00
Alexey Sokolov
d185d6f22d clang-format: switch tabs to spaces
I like tabs, but I have to admit that spaces make source code more
consistent, because every editor/viewer tends to render tabs differently :(
2015-12-07 00:53:30 +00:00
Alexey Sokolov
33b0627d75 Add clang-format configuration.
For now, it uses tabs like before, to make the diff easier to read/check.
One of following commits will switch it to spaces.
2015-12-07 00:53:01 +00:00
Alexey Sokolov
02f8749a8b Protect some parts of code from clang-format 2015-12-07 00:48:58 +00:00
Alexey Sokolov
7f6fc6643e Merge branch 'master' into notify
Conflicts:
    test/Integration.cpp
2015-11-30 08:02:47 +00:00
Alexey Sokolov
d736397194 Small change for test of notify_connect for better variety 2015-11-30 08:00:51 +00:00
Alexey Sokolov
569f057561 Call CTCP callback for actions too, as it was before switch to CMessage.
Partyline had both of callbacks, one of which is redundant.

Fix #1134
Fix #1190
2015-11-29 00:59:50 +00:00
Oleh Prypin
50edbd5f0d Test notify_connect module 2015-11-27 12:20:33 +02:00
KindOne
6ac59ee4df Add test for controlpanel 2015-11-06 20:45:38 -05:00
Alexey Sokolov
29847146cf Make channel test more reliable 2015-11-01 23:01:05 +00:00
Alexey Sokolov
900a11a1a9 Fix test which I've just broken 2015-11-01 22:44:50 +00:00
Alexey Sokolov
585b380189 How did I manage to write invalid JOIN test? 2015-11-01 22:26:24 +00:00
Alexey Sokolov
34026d39dc Add test for shell module 2015-10-31 20:36:58 +00:00
Alexey Sokolov
5e337647b1 Add test for invalid channel config. 2015-10-30 14:33:46 +00:00
Alexey Sokolov
9777a1a667 Add test for fix of #528 2015-10-30 01:06:39 +00:00
Alexey Sokolov
69b031c43c Workaround test failure on cygwin64 2015-10-24 11:56:23 +01:00
Alexey Sokolov
db550a3aa0 Add one more small test. 2015-10-20 08:12:34 +01:00
Alexey Sokolov
a35a5d3bc8 Test: add typedef for a widely used type 2015-10-20 08:02:46 +01:00
Alexey Sokolov
38288a17e9 Test: slightly more compact output 2015-10-20 08:00:36 +01:00
Alexey Sokolov
933aa6db0c Add some more tests and fix a bug which sometimes blocked login of users.
This bug wasn't released yet.
cc @jpnurmi
2015-10-18 23:22:32 +01:00
Alexey Sokolov
eb450ee885 Test: extract some building blocks to make future tests easier 2015-10-18 22:23:42 +01:00
Alexey Sokolov
1caf6541a0 Test: workaround some Qt's annoyances, and add one more small test. 2015-10-18 21:39:59 +01:00
Alexey Sokolov
90ae78533f Rewrite integration test.
Pexpect was failing too often, even when starting a new process.
Now the test is using Qt and C++.

Fix #772
2015-10-17 15:27:18 +01:00